Mobile
Log In
Sign Up
Tools
Translator
Alphabet
Home
Chinese-English
English-Chinese
French-English
English-French
Home
>
chinese-english
>
"smart-aleck" in English
English translation for "
smart-aleck
"
自作聪明,自以为样样都懂;刚愎自用。
Similar Words:
"smart unicorn solutions" English translation
,
"smart waving" English translation
,
"smart zoom" English translation
,
"smart-1" English translation
,
"smart-alec" English translation
,
"smart-aleckism" English translation
,
"smart-aleckry" English translation
,
"smart-alecky" English translation
,
"smart-card reader" English translation
,
"smart-clone" English translation